What is ABCD Analysis in Business Models?
ABCD Analysis in Business Models applies the Advantages, Benefits, Constraints, Disadvantages framework to evaluate the viability of business strategies, models, and operational systems.
P. S. Aithal introduced ABCD Analysis as a research methodology for company case studies in 2017, cited 289 times. It structures evaluation of business models through four dimensions, as detailed in Aithal's 2016 study on business models and strategies with 109 citations. Applications span e-commerce placements and sustainable strategies, with over 1,000 citations across related papers.

Key Research Challenges
Quantifying Constraints Subjectivity
ABCD Analysis struggles with subjective interpretation of constraints and disadvantages in diverse business contexts. Aithal (2017) notes challenges in standardizing metrics across case studies (289 citations). This limits comparability between models.
Scalability Beyond Case Studies
Extending ABCD from single-company cases to industry-wide models lacks robust frameworks. Shenoy and Aithal's 2017 quantitative ABCD of IEDRA model highlights scalability dilemmas (127 citations). Validation across sectors remains inconsistent.
Integrating Quantitative Metrics
Combining qualitative ABCD dimensions with statistical measures is underdeveloped. Aithal and Aithal's 2016 factor analysis paper identifies gaps in research indices (108 citations). Empirical validation methods need enhancement.
